UK laws surrounding HID xenon bulbs According to the letter of UK law, HID xenon lights are not permitted. However, European type approval regulations do allow them, and therefore they must be allowed on EU cars registered in the UK. Is 8000K HID legal?
Xenon HID bulbs with a high colour temperature – such as 8000K or above – are sometimes not road legal. Halogen bulbs with a colour temperature of 4300K or over also tend to be non-road legal. This can sometimes make bulbs a very crisp white/blue colour and therefore unsuitable for road use.

Are HID kits illegal?
In a nutshell, HID kits are not road legal, because they’re classed as an aftermarket modification.
Will HID pass MOT?
You can fit an aftermarket HID kit to a UK vehicle, and as long as the beam pattern is correct, the light is predominantly white or yellow-white, there is no glare for other road users, and the light passes all the standard MOT test checks such as being secure and pointing in the right direction, then you should be …
What is brighter 6000K or 10000k?
The 6000k is usually the most popular. The higher you go in the Kelvin Rating, you get more color in the light in exchange for visibility. So 6000k will be just slightly brighter than 8000k and 8000k will be slightly brighter than 10000k and so on but they will have more and more color to them.

Is it legal to use aftermarket HID headlamps?
Advice on using aftermarket HID headlamps and the legal way to convert vehicles to Xenon HID. This information sheet provides guidance on aftermarket HID headlamps. The Department for Transport takes the view that it’s not legal to sell or use lighting kits to convert standard halogen headlamps to HID xenon headlamps.

Can a hid conversion kit damage a halogen headlamp?
According to Lukas Küpper, Philips Automotive’s senior lighting engineer, an incompatible bulb from an HID conversion kit can also damage a halogen headlamp internally through excessive heat generation and ultra-violet radiation. The vehicle’s wiring may also not be a match for the different current loadings.
